In a emotional and emotional video shared by Barstool Sports, a significant milestone is captured as a young student heads off to high school. The video, titled "Off to high school 🫡 @Barstool U (via:Chezsharon/ig)", reveals a touching moment that has resonated with viewers across social media.

The video showcases a parent's heartfelt reaction as their child embarks on this new journey. With emotions running high, the parent is heard saying, "I'm gonna cry! I'm gonna cry! I'm gonna cry! Oh my god!" This raw display of emotion highlights the bittersweet nature of watching a child grow up and take on new challenges.

In a lighter moment, the conversation shifts to practical matters, with the student asking, "I've gone from my tires to 40 PSI, is that okay?" The parent's reassuring response, "That's pretty high, you'll make it!" adds a touch of humor to the poignant scene.

As the student prepares to leave, the parent offers a heartfelt farewell, "Alright, see ya! Bye honey, we love you! Bye!" The emotional weight of the moment is palpable, culminating in the parent's final words, "I'm crying!"

This video, shared via the Instagram account Chezsharon and promoted by Barstool Sports, beautifully captures the mix of pride, worry, and love that accompanies such significant life events. It's a must-watch for anyone who appreciates genuine, heartfelt moments.
